
Apple explains why the iPhone 15 overheats and the way it plans to repair it
Over the previous week, the launch of the iPhone 15 has been considerably overshadowed by widespread studies of overheating. In line with many customers on X (formerly Twitter)Reddit and Apple boards New telephones can get too scorching to carry. Apple has lastly responded and confirmed {that a} repair is on the way in which.
In an announcement to the media, Apple expressed confidence that the issue is said to the software program and never the A17 Professional chip or titanium casing. The corporate focused three potential causes of overheating in some iPhone 15 Professional fashions:
- Apple says iPhones “could really feel heat throughout the first few days after organising or restoring the system on account of elevated background exercise.” This can be a pretty frequent challenge with new smartphones however it appears to have been all the craze with the launch of the iPhone 15.
- Some apps (together with Instagram and Uber) not too long ago up to date to assist iOS 17 overload the A17 Professional chipset’s CPU. Apple says it’s working with affected builders on fixes which might be within the works.
- A bug in iOS 17 that “impacts some customers” can be addressed in a future software program replace.
Apple insists that the overheating points will not be associated to the A17 Professional processor, the iPhone 15’s titanium physique, or its up to date inside design. The corporate additionally quashed a report from Ming-Chi Kuo that it might restrict efficiency to maintain the system-on-chip cool below heavy hundreds, saying it “is not going to cut back the efficiency of the A17 Professional chip” as a part of deliberate fixes. .
Apple started testing iOS 17.1 on Wednesday, although the repair could come as a part of the iOS 17.0.3 replace as nicely.
